Plot Summary
This documentary chronicles the extraordinary career and personal journey of WWE superstar Big Show, whose immense physical presence was matched only by his impact inside and outside the wrestling ring. The film delves into his rise to fame, his most memorable rivalries, and the physical and emotional challenges he faced throughout his two-decade tenure in professional wrestling. It offers a candid look at the man behind the larger-than-life persona, exploring his transition into retirement and his reflections on a career that redefined the meaning of 'superstar'.

Fun Fact
During his time in WWE, Big Show was famously referred to as 'The World's Largest Athlete', a testament to his unique combination of size and athletic ability which stood at 7 feet tall and over 500 pounds for much of his career.
